Summary:"This volume details the life and times of Dr. Henry Porter, through his work as an Army surgeon and early medical practitioner in the western territories of Arizona, Dakota, and Montana. Most importantly, the work discusses Porter's role in and firsthand observations of the infamous Battle of Little Bighorn where he was one of the few survivors"--Provided by publisher.
